Description

4-Bromo-7-Chloro-1H-Indazole is a high-value halogenated indazole derivative serving as a critical building block in modern organic synthesis. Its molecular structure makes it an essential intermediate for the development of novel pharmaceuticals and advanced materials. This compound is primarily sought after by research institutions and manufacturers in the pharmaceutical, agrochemical, and specialty chemical industries for constructing complex heterocyclic frameworks.

Application

  • Pharmaceutical Intermediate: A key synthon in the research and development of new drug candidates, particularly kinase inhibitors and other biologically active molecules.
  • Agrochemical Synthesis: Used in the creation of advanced pesticides and herbicides, leveraging its halogenated indazole core.
  • Material Science Research: Serves as a precursor for the synthesis of organic electronic materials and functional dyes.
  • Chemical Biology: Employed as a molecular probe or a tag in biochemical research and assay development.
  • Custom Synthesis: A versatile starting material for contract research organizations (CROs) and CDMOs for bespoke chemical synthesis projects.

Basic Information

Product Name 4-Bromo-7-Chloro-1H-Indazole
CAS No. 1186334-61-1
Molecular Formula C7H4BrClN2
Molecular Weight 231.48 g/mol
Synonyms 7-Chloro-4-bromo-1H-indazole; 4-Bromo-7-chloroindazole; 1H-Indazole, 4-bromo-7-chloro-; 1186334-61-1; 4-Br-7-Cl-1H-indazole

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at room temperature (15-25°C). The compound is light-sensitive and should be handled under appropriate conditions to maintain stability.
